Exhibiting Again


Goddess Collage, Mix media 12" x 12" on canvas


Hello Friends,

In December my artwork "Collage" was on exhibit at the Escondido Municipal Art Gallery. It was the first time I exhibited my work at this gallery.  Previously I had done so at the Escondido Art Association.  I was at the Artist reception and it is always nice to meet other artist, and see their creations.

In January I took sometime off and went to Monterey, CA. I had a wonderful week there. I went to the next town, Carmel, which is full of beautiful art galleries. I visited every single one and saw much beauty. Unfortunately it seems like some of them are going out of business due to the economy, which was surprising to see.

I also went to Pacific Grove, CA, to their Art Association there and met a wonderful photographer, by the name of Jean Brenner. Her photography exhibit on "The Faces of Islam" is wonderful to see. I was lucky that she was there and that she gracefully took time to explain some of the history behind her photos.

I'm looking forward to a year of art :)

Working with Mix Media

Deep Blue, Mix Media on 12"x12" canvas
























Hello Friends,

I've been really enjoying creating mix media artwork.  My creativity is unleashed as I consider not only the type of paints and ink I would like to use, but papers, plastics, natural objects, and anything that could add texture, color, and that Je nais se quoi factor.

The artwork is really varied too. From simple child like artwork, to collage, to abstract.  My imagination is the limit.  It's just really fun.  Once I have 30 pieces of artwork I will do an online auction to raise funds for the Boldly Creating Life Foundation. This foundation brings art back into the classrooms of public elementary school that do not currently have an art program.  It is hard to believe but our kids nowadays are going from kindergarten to 5th grade without a single art class!

If we can offer just one class to a child who has not been exposed to art, we are really providing for them a doorway to his/her imagination and creativity.  A single class could be all that is needed, to show a child that there is a world of art ready to be discovered.
